Spring Valley, CA Assisted Living & Board and Care Homes
Spring Valley, California is a suburb of San Diego, with a lake, hiking trails and parks that will keep the outdoor lover in you very happy. It is highly rated for outdoor living, diversity and the weather and for a community of only 30,000, it’s surprising to see ten board and care homes and assisted living facilities in Spring Valley, CA area. That suggests that Spring Valley is a very friendly place for seniors to settle into. Have a look. Visit some of these board and care homes and assisted living facilities. Talk to some of the folks that live in them. There is a good chance you’ll find something well worth calling home.
Most of the assisted living homes and board and care facilities in Spring Valley, CA are pretty average when it comes to size, with one very big exception. One of the assisted living facilities here is actually a gated community, with a mix of independent living and assisted living residents, and that creates a very different atmosphere. This feels more like a neighborhood than anything else, with space to roam, room to play and various places to get together with your neighbors and socialize. On the opposite end of the spectrum are board and care homes, with no more than 6 residents, living in a shared home where everything is much more compact. Which do you prefer? Visit both before you decide.
Frequently Asked Questions About Assisted Living in Spring Valley, CA
What services are typically offered in assisted living facilities in Spring Valley, CA?
Assisted living facilities in Spring Valley, CA, generally provide a wide range of services designed to support residents in their daily activities while maintaining their independence. These services often include assistance with personal care, such as bathing, dressing, and grooming, medication management, and housekeeping services. Residents typically have access to meals, transportation, and social and recreational activities that cater to their interests and abilities. Some facilities may also offer specialized services like memory care for residents with dementia or Alzheimer’s disease, and wellness programs that focus on maintaining physical and mental health. Some may provide on-site healthcare services or coordinate with local healthcare providers for more comprehensive care.
What should families consider when choosing an assisted living facility in Spring Valley, CA?
When selecting an assisted living facility in Spring Valley, CA, families should consider several key factors to ensure the best fit for their loved one. First, the level of care provided should match the resident's current and anticipated needs, including services for personal care, medical needs, and specialized care like memory care. The location of the facility is also important, as proximity to family, friends, and familiar surroundings can greatly impact the resident's well-being. Additionally, families should evaluate the facility's amenities, activities, and overall environment to ensure it aligns with the resident's lifestyle and preferences. It’s also crucial to consider the staff-to-resident ratio, the qualifications and experience of the staff, and the facility's reputation within the community. Finally, cost and payment options are important, and families should inquire about what is included in the base price and what services might incur additional charges.
What is the process for moving into an assisted living facility in Spring Valley, CA?
The process of moving into an assisted living facility in Spring Valley, CA, generally involves several steps to ensure a smooth transition. First, families should research and tour multiple facilities to find the one that best meets their loved one's needs. Once a facility is chosen, the next step is to complete a thorough assessment, typically conducted by the facility's staff or a healthcare professional, to determine the level of care required. After the assessment, the resident and their family will review and sign the residency agreement, which outlines the services provided, costs, and terms of residence. It’s important to carefully read and understand this contract. The final steps involve planning the move, which includes downsizing, packing, and organizing the resident's belongings. Many facilities offer moving services or can recommend companies that specialize in senior relocations. Coordination with the facility staff is key during this time to ensure a seamless transition.
How do assisted living facilities handle medical emergencies?
Assisted living facilities should be equipped to handle medical emergencies with well-established protocols to ensure resident safety. As a general rule, assisted living facilities should have trained staff available 24/7 who can respond immediately to any emergency. In the event of a medical crisis, staff members should be trained to provide basic first aid, administer CPR, and call 911 if necessary. Facilities often have emergency alert systems in place, such as call buttons in residents' rooms, which allow them to quickly request assistance. Additionally, many assisted living communities have partnerships with nearby hospitals and medical centers, ensuring prompt access to advanced medical care. Family members are typically notified as soon as possible in the event of an emergency. Some facilities also have on-site healthcare professionals, such as nurses or doctors, who can provide immediate care and assess the situation before determining whether hospitalization is required.

How do assisted living facilities in California ensure the safety and security of their residents?
Safety and security are top priorities for assisted living facilities. To ensure a safe environment, many facilities are equipped with 24-hour security systems, including controlled access points, surveillance cameras, and alarm systems that monitor for unauthorized entry. Residents often have access to emergency call systems in their rooms and common areas, allowing them to quickly request help if needed. Many facilities employ trained security personnel who monitor the premises and assist in enforcing safety protocols. In addition to physical security measures, facilities often implement comprehensive safety policies that include regular fire drills, emergency preparedness training for staff, and stringent infection control procedures. Staff members should also be trained in de-escalation techniques and first aid, ensuring they are prepared to handle various situations. Family members can be reassured that these measures are in place to protect their loved ones while maintaining a comfortable and supportive living environment.
